|
|
Другие темы раздела | |||||||||||||||||||||||
Bash Выполнение локального скрипта на удаленной машине средствами Expect, Bash, SSH
https://www.cyberforum.ru/ shell/ thread1986713.html Уважаемые знатоки! Есть задача, выполнить небольшой скрипт на удаленных машинах. Соединение ssh с машинами проходит средствами expect в автоматическом режиме. Какой командой заставить expect исполнить скрипт на удаленной машине? Сам скрипт должен находится на машине с которой идем по ssh. Команда ssh -t user@IP "$(cat /путь/до/скрипта)" к сожалению не работает. |
Bash Транслятор bbcode to html Доброго времени суток! Ситуация такая: нужен батник, который текстовый файл с bbcode перерабатывал в html, т.е нахадил слова(теги bbcode) и заменял их на другие слова (теги html) и сохранял всё это безобразие в новый файл .html пример: файл с bbcode: hello, wolrd! батник перерабатывает его в новый файл .html: <b>hello, world</b> Спасибо!!!! | ||||||||||||||||||||||
Bash Что это за вычисление : var=${var%?} Вот такой скрипт #!/usr/bin/env bash var="" var=строка var=${var%?} echo echo $var При вычислении переменной происходит удаление последнего символа из стека. https://www.cyberforum.ru/ shell/ thread1985656.html |
Bash Поясните пожайлуста механизм работы - PASSWORD=$PASSWORD$BUFF - в цикле
https://www.cyberforum.ru/ shell/ thread1984737.html Мне непонятен механизм работы вот такого написания переменной. PASSWORD=$PASSWORD$BUFF # PASSWORD=$BUFF$PASSWORD Как это называется ? Вот кусок скрипта, с пояснениями | ||||||||||||||||||||||
Шифрование пароля внутри скрипта Bash Bash В windows при подготовке файла ответов , можно было ввести через менеджер подготовки файла ответов пароль, но когда сохранялся сам файл ответов, и читался в обычном редакторе, то пароль в нем был зашифрован. Есть ли такой механизм в Bash ? Чтобы избегать ввода пароля руками, когда этого требует команда в сценарии... Если - это так, как это можно организовать? |
Bash Создание командного файла, формирующий архив
https://www.cyberforum.ru/ shell/ thread1984441.html Задание:Разработать командный файл (скрипт) Bash, который формирует в текущем каталоге архив archive.zip из файлов каталога, заданного 1- м параметром, длина которых не меньше числа, заданного 2-м параметром. (Если архив существует - заменять!) Какие команды мне бы пригодились? | ||||||||||||||||||||||
Bash Может ли for построчно разобрать файл Нашел вот такую информацию for – будет выполнять действие до тех пор, пока есть объекты для выполнения (например – чтение потока из stdin, файла или функции); попробовал написать простой пример #!/usr/bin/env bash for variable in /home/user/scripts/tmp1/select.txt do https://www.cyberforum.ru/ shell/ thread1983916.html |
Оператор выбора - select - нет показывает значение переменной Bash Я разбираю пример , написанный на ресурсе opennet.ru, но не могу понять почему он не отрабатывает выдачу значения введенной переменной, как задумано в сценарии, из-за этого не могу понять механизм работы оператора select Помогите разобраться #!/usr/bin/env bash PS3='Выберите ваш любимый овощ: ' # строка приглашения к вводу (prompt) echo select vegetable in "бобы" "морковь"... | ||||||||||||||||||||||
Bash Рекурсивное скачивание файлов shell
https://www.cyberforum.ru/ shell/ thread1983655.html Доброго времени суток! Получил задачу, которую совершенно не могу решить. Написать скрипт, который получит параметром страницу в интрнете. Скрипт должен её скачать, найти на ней все эмеилы(я думаю поиска по @ достаточно) и сохранить в документ. Потом найти все ссылки(я так понимаю можно сделать это поиском слова href) и скачать все те страницы. Проделать на них тоже самое. Да, скрипт скорее всего... |
Bash Найти все файлы которые не принадлежат текущему пользователю
https://www.cyberforum.ru/ shell/ thread1983577.html Ребята, кто может помочь, посмотрите задание пожалуйста! Дали написать скрип, но я не знаю как... В домашнем каталоге найти все файлы которые не принадлежат текущему пользователю. Преместить их у папку otheruser. Список этих файлов записать в файл otheruser.txt. Для всех остальных файлов, снять право на запись для других пользователей. Кому не трудно, и есть время, помогите, буду безумно... | ||||||||||||||||||||||
В tsch скопировать недостающую подпапку для каждой папки директорий Bash Помогите пожалуйста! Оболочка tsch. Необходимо для терминала Linux написать скрипт: есть в 1 директории папки 1,2,3... В каждой папке папки a,b,c есть в 2 директории папки 1,2,3... В каждой папке папки a, b Необходимо скопировать недостающую "c" для каждой папки директорий соотвественно. https://www.cyberforum.ru/attachments/833373 |
Bash Найти в файлах ключевые слова Здравствуйте, нужно поискать слова из файла в других файлах, при этом файлов у нас много, и пути к этим файлам записаны в файле patch.txt, сами слова записаны тоже в файле key.txt, написал такой скрипт, но выполняет он не совсем правильно, кто может подсказать что не правильно. #!/bin/bash filepath='/home/artem/Desktop/patch.txt' wordkey='/home/artem/Desktop/key.txt' echo Start while read... https://www.cyberforum.ru/ shell/ thread1983156.html |
5985 / 1994 / 323
Регистрация: 10.12.2013
Сообщений: 6,875
|
||||||
24.05.2017, 06:14 | 0 | |||||
Не получается корректно заменить символы (sed) - Bash - Ответ 1047126524.05.2017, 06:14. Показов 3855. Ответов 6
Метки (Все метки)
Ответ
да, месье знает толк в извращениях;
через управляемый backtracking:
Вернуться к обсуждению: Не получается корректно заменить символы (sed) Bash
0
|
24.05.2017, 06:14 | |
Готовые ответы и решения:
6
Sed: заменить только первое найденное либо в интервале строк Не корректно отображаются русские символы Работа с текстовыми файлами. Произвольные символы заменить на символы, введенные с клавиатуры Не получается корректно скопировать форму |
24.05.2017, 06:14 | |
24.05.2017, 06:14 | |
Помогаю со студенческими работами здесь
0
Заглавные символы кириллицы заменить на строчные латинские символы Заменить все латинские символы «а» на символы «А» во введенной строке Как в UnicodeString быстро заменить символы на другие символы ? Заполнить матрицу А[N,M] с файла символами, если символы повторяются в рядах то эти же символы заменить на их коды. |